How Has the Current Water Temperature in Key West, FL Changed Over Time?

The current water temperature in Key West, FL, has shown variations over time due to several factors. Seasonal changes, ocean currents, and climate patterns affect these temperatures. Historically, water temperatures in Key West are warmer during the summer months and cooler during winter. On average, summer temperatures range from 78°F to 86°F (26°C to 30°C), while winter temperatures can dip to around 65°F to 75°F (18°C to 24°C). Data from the past decades indicates a gradual increase in average water temperature. This rise correlates with global climate change and rising sea surface temperatures. The Florida Keys are now experiencing higher minimum and maximum temperatures compared to historical averages. Therefore, while current temperature readings fluctuate daily, the overarching trend reflects an increase over the years.

How Do Seasonal Variations Impact the Current Water Temperature in Key West, FL?

Seasonal variations significantly impact the current water temperature in Key West, FL, affecting marine life, recreational activities, and local weather patterns.

Key points that explain the impact of seasonal changes on water temperature include:

  1. Summer Heating: In summer, warmer air temperatures heat the water. The average water temperature can reach around 86°F (30°C) during this season, as indicated by the National Oceanic and Atmospheric Administration (NOAA, 2021). Higher temperatures provide optimal conditions for marine organisms like corals and fish.

  2. Winter Cooling: In winter, cooler air temperatures lower the water temperature. January water averages drop to around 70°F (21°C), according to NOAA data. This drop can influence fish migration patterns, as some species prefer warmer waters.

  3. Transient Seasonal Changes: In the transitional seasons of spring and fall, water temperatures fluctuate but typically remain mild, averaging between 75°F (24°C) and 80°F (27°C). These seasonal shifts can affect local tourism. For example, warmer water draws more divers and fishermen.

  4. Weather Events: Seasonal weather patterns, such as hurricanes or cold fronts, can cause abrupt changes in water temperature. A study by Beavers et al. (2018) documented how such weather events introduced cooler surface temperatures temporarily but increased mixing of deeper, warmer ocean layers.

  5. Cyclic Patterns: Seasonal changes produce cyclic patterns in marine ecosystem dynamics. Coral spawning, for instance, often aligns with warmer water temperatures in late summer. This timing is crucial for successful reproduction in coral species.

Understanding these seasonal variations helps anticipate local climate impacts and guides decisions for fishing, boating, and tourism activities in Key West, FL.

  1. Rising Average Temperatures: Rising average temperatures refer to the overall increase in water temperature over time. Studies indicate that ocean temperatures in the Florida Keys have risen by approximately 1.5°F since the 1980s (NOAA, 2020). This trend is expected to continue, affecting marine ecosystems and weather patterns.

  2. Increased Frequency of Marine Heatwaves: Increased frequency of marine heatwaves presents periods when ocean temperatures rise significantly above normal levels. Research has shown that such events are becoming more common due to climate change. A notable example occurred in 2022, when Key West experienced prolonged heat conditions that stressed coral reefs.

  3. Impact on Coral Reefs and Marine Life: The impact on coral reefs and marine life highlights how warmer waters harm ecosystems. Elevated temperatures lead to coral bleaching, reduced reproductive rates, and altered species distributions. The National Oceanic and Atmospheric Administration (NOAA) reports that Florida’s coral reefs have already been severely affected, with predictions suggesting further decline (NOAA, 2021).

  4. Seasonal Temperature Variations: Seasonal temperature variations indicate differences in water temperatures throughout the year. Summer months generally see a peak in temperatures, while winters are cooler. Climate data suggests that summer averages could rise further, shifting marine species’ behaviors and habitats.

  5. Influence of Ocean Currents: The influence of ocean currents shapes temperature trends in Key West. Currents can distribute warmer waters and impact local climates. The Gulf Stream, a significant current affecting Florida, may change due to global warming, leading to altered temperature patterns.
